A Healthy Approach To Dealing With NIMBYism


County Board of Supervisor Antonovich has appointed a task force to investigate locations for next year’s Winter Shelter program in the Santa Clarita Valley, just north of Los Angeles. (Here’s an article.)

In past years, finding a location for emergency shelter in this area has been contentious. Like other neighborhoods, local residents have fought tooth and nail to prevent homeless programs from locating in their community.

The Supervisor has appointed local leaders from business, homeowner associations, and political offices to represent the community.

This is an excellent proactive way to deal with NIMBYism (“Not In My Backyard”) in a community. I applaud the Supervisor’s effort.
